ALSA: usb-audio: Fix substream assignments

In 3.5 kernel, the endpoint is assigned dynamically for the
substreams, but the PCM assignment still checks the presence of the
endpoint pointer.  This ended up in duplicated PCM substream creations
at probing time, resulting in kernel warnings like:

This patch fixes the regression by checking the fixed endpoint number
for each substream instead of the endpoint pointer.
